    Understanding Polycystic Kidney Disease

      Polycystic kidney disease (PKD) is a genetic disorder characterized by the growth of numerous cysts in the kidneys. These cysts can vary in size and can significantly impair kidney function over time, leading to complications such as high blood pressure, kidney stones, and even kidney failure. While conventional treatments focus on managing symptoms and slowing disease progression, many individuals are turning to tra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) for holistic and natural approaches to support kidney health.


    TCM Principles for Kidney Health

      Traditional Chinese medicine views the kidneys as the foundation of vitality and essence in the body. According to TCM theory, PKD is often attributed to imbalances in the body's qi (vital energy), blood circulation, and the accumulation of dampness and phlegm. TCM treatments aim to restore harmony and balance within the body, promoting overall well-being and supporting kidney function.
